×Digital ID Login is a cryptographic authentication method that primarily relies on public-key cryptography to securely authenticate users. It leverages digital wallets and certificates to verify users, eliminating the risks associated with password theft, phishing, and credential stuffing. With digital identity verification, users authenticate using a unique digital identity tied to their digital wallet. Digital ID Login uses decentralized identity (DID) and verifiable credentials to authenticate users with cryptographic proofs, eliminating passwords and central databases.
